La enseñanza de la lengua inglesa en el sistema educativo español: de la legislación al aula como entidad social (1970-2000)
Javier Barbero Andrés. Universidad de Cantabria
 Los cambios sociales experimentados por nuestro país en las últimas tres décadas del siglo XX alcanzan de forma ineludible el ámbito educativo. Si asumimos como válida la premisa de que el microcosmos educativo y, concretamente, el ámbito curricular de la lengua inglesa acompasan su evolución a los cambios mencionados podríamos afirmar que el ámbito escolar reproduce, al tiempo que resiste y transforma, el tipo de relaciones que caracterizan la sociedad en la que se inscribe.

Re-Imagining Learning in the 21st Century


In 2006, MacArthur launched the digital media and learning initiative to test the notion that public education would have to transform to prepare young people for the complex and connected social, economic, and political demands of the 21st century.

PROJECT CORNERSTONE
Our school is currently putting every effort into increasing the level of English quantitatively and qualitatively; we have deemed appropiate to have an activity which would involve every student so they could share their daily learning in a close, motivating and visual way with the rest of the students.
MAIN AIM
Incorporating globally and indirectally the foreign language in their daily routine.

SPECIFIC AIMS
  • Exchanging information among classmates in order to work and produce collaborative learning.
  • Putting together different ideas suggested by students and teachers so as to enhance the learning process.
  • Producing pod casts, videos and news based on school contents for a class-oriented weblog.
  • Identifying and relating other people work to schoolwork.
  • To enjoy working as a group.
  • Understanding and considering in a positive way the work of the rest of the people.
  • Showing empathy to the feelings of all the community: students and teachers.
  • Thinking about our own linguistic experiences.
  • To form an opinion about other people work.
  • Considering and evaluating our work using a critical eye.
